  • E160a - Carotene


    Carotene: The term carotene -also carotin, from the Latin carota, "carrot"- is used for many related unsaturated hydrocarbon substances having the formula C40Hx, which are synthesized by plants but in general cannot be made by animals -with the exception of some aphids and spider mites which acquired the synthesizing genes from fungi-. Carotenes are photosynthetic pigments important for photosynthesis. Carotenes contain no oxygen atoms. They absorb ultraviolet, violet, and blue light and scatter orange or red light, and -in low concentrations- yellow light. Carotenes are responsible for the orange colour of the carrot, for which this class of chemicals is named, and for the colours of many other fruits, vegetables and fungi -for example, sweet potatoes, chanterelle and orange cantaloupe melon-. Carotenes are also responsible for the orange -but not all of the yellow- colours in dry foliage. They also -in lower concentrations- impart the yellow coloration to milk-fat and butter. Omnivorous animal species which are relatively poor converters of coloured dietary carotenoids to colourless retinoids have yellowed-coloured body fat, as a result of the carotenoid retention from the vegetable portion of their diet. The typical yellow-coloured fat of humans and chickens is a result of fat storage of carotenes from their diets. Carotenes contribute to photosynthesis by transmitting the light energy they absorb to chlorophyll. They also protect plant tissues by helping to absorb the energy from singlet oxygen, an excited form of the oxygen molecule O2 which is formed during photosynthesis. β-Carotene is composed of two retinyl groups, and is broken down in the mucosa of the human small intestine by β-carotene 15‚15'-monooxygenase to retinal, a form of vitamin A. β-Carotene can be stored in the liver and body fat and converted to retinal as needed, thus making it a form of vitamin A for humans and some other mammals. The carotenes α-carotene and γ-carotene, due to their single retinyl group -β-ionone ring-, also have some vitamin A activity -though less than β-carotene-, as does the xanthophyll carotenoid β-cryptoxanthin. All other carotenoids, including lycopene, have no beta-ring and thus no vitamin A activity -although they may have antioxidant activity and thus biological activity in other ways-. Animal species differ greatly in their ability to convert retinyl -beta-ionone- containing carotenoids to retinals. Carnivores in general are poor converters of dietary ionone-containing carotenoids. Pure carnivores such as ferrets lack β-carotene 15‚15'-monooxygenase and cannot convert any carotenoids to retinals at all -resulting in carotenes not being a form of vitamin A for this species-; while cats can convert a trace of β-carotene to retinol, although the amount is totally insufficient for meeting their daily retinol needs.

  • E160ai - Beta-carotene


    Beta-Carotene: β-Carotene is an organic, strongly colored red-orange pigment abundant in plants and fruits. It is a member of the carotenes, which are terpenoids -isoprenoids-, synthesized biochemically from eight isoprene units and thus having 40 carbons. Among the carotenes, β-carotene is distinguished by having beta-rings at both ends of the molecule. β-Carotene is biosynthesized from geranylgeranyl pyrophosphate.β-Carotene is the most common form of carotene in plants. When used as a food coloring, it has the E number E160a. The structure was deduced by Karrer et al. in 1930. In nature, β-carotene is a precursor -inactive form- to vitamin A via the action of beta-carotene 15‚15'-monooxygenase.Isolation of β-carotene from fruits abundant in carotenoids is commonly done using column chromatography. It can also be extracted from the beta-carotene rich algae, Dunaliella salina. The separation of β-carotene from the mixture of other carotenoids is based on the polarity of a compound. β-Carotene is a non-polar compound, so it is separated with a non-polar solvent such as hexane. Being highly conjugated, it is deeply colored, and as a hydrocarbon lacking functional groups, it is very lipophilic.

  • E202 - Potassium sorbate


    Potassium sorbate (E202) is a synthetic food preservative commonly used to extend the shelf life of various food products.

    It works by inhibiting the growth of molds, yeast, and some bacteria, preventing spoilage. When added to foods, it helps maintain their freshness and quality.

    Some studies have shown that when combined with nitrites, potassium sorbate have genotoxic activity in vitro. However, potassium sorbate is generally recognized as safe (GRAS) by regulatory authorities.

  • E322 - Lecithins


    Lecithins are natural compounds commonly used in the food industry as emulsifiers and stabilizers.

    Extracted from sources like soybeans and eggs, lecithins consist of phospholipids that enhance the mixing of oil and water, ensuring smooth textures in various products like chocolates, dressings, and baked goods.

    They do not present any known health risks.

  • E407 - Carrageenan


    Carrageenan (E407), derived from red seaweed, is widely employed in the food industry as a gelling, thickening, and stabilizing agent, notably in dairy and meat products.

    It can exist in various forms, each imparting distinct textural properties to food.

    However, its degraded form, often referred to as poligeenan, has raised health concerns due to its potential inflammatory effects and its classification as a possible human carcinogen (Group 2B) by the International Agency for Research on Cancer (IARC).

    Nevertheless, food-grade carrageenan has been deemed safe by various regulatory bodies when consumed in amounts typically found in food.

  • E414 - Acacia gum


    Gum arabic: Gum arabic, also known as acacia gum, arabic gum, gum acacia, acacia, Senegal gum and Indian gum, and by other names, is a natural gum consisting of the hardened sap of various species of the acacia tree. Originally, gum arabic was collected from Acacia nilotica which was called the "gum arabic tree"; in the present day, gum arabic is collected from acacia species, predominantly Acacia senegal and Vachellia -Acacia- seyal; the term "gum arabic" does not indicate a particular botanical source. In a few cases so‐called "gum arabic" may not even have been collected from Acacia species, but may originate from Combretum, Albizia or some other genus. Producers harvest the gum commercially from wild trees, mostly in Sudan -80%- and throughout the Sahel, from Senegal to Somalia—though it is historically cultivated in Arabia and West Asia. Gum arabic is a complex mixture of glycoproteins and polysaccharides. It is the original source of the sugars arabinose and ribose, both of which were first discovered and isolated from it, and are named after it. Gum arabic is soluble in water. It is edible, and used primarily in the food industry as a stabilizer, with EU E number E414. Gum arabic is a key ingredient in traditional lithography and is used in printing, paint production, glue, cosmetics and various industrial applications, including viscosity control in inks and in textile industries, though less expensive materials compete with it for many of these roles. While gum arabic is now produced throughout the African Sahel, it is still harvested and used in the Middle East.

  • E500 - Sodium carbonates


    Sodium carbonates (E500) are compounds commonly used in food preparation as leavening agents, helping baked goods rise by releasing carbon dioxide when they interact with acids.

    Often found in baking soda, they regulate the pH of food, preventing it from becoming too acidic or too alkaline. In the culinary world, sodium carbonates can also enhance the texture and structure of foods, such as noodles, by modifying the gluten network.

    Generally recognized as safe, sodium carbonates are non-toxic when consumed in typical amounts found in food.

  • E500ii - Sodium hydrogen carbonate


    Sodium hydrogen carbonate, also known as E500ii, is a food additive commonly used as a leavening agent.

    When added to recipes, it releases carbon dioxide gas upon exposure to heat or acids, causing dough to rise and resulting in a light, fluffy texture in baked goods.

    It is generally recognized as safe (GRAS) by regulatory authorities when used in appropriate quantities and poses no significant health risks when consumed in typical food applications.
